martinthomson requested changes on this pull request. > Servers MUST ignore an initial plaintext packet from a client if its total size is less than 1200 octets. +Similarly, servers MUST ensure that the first handshake packet they send to Use capital H here and maybe be more explicit. A Version Negotiation or Retry packet shouldn't be larger, and in fact should be kept small. (We can't pad Version Negotiation anyway, except with greasing values, which isn't much use.) > Servers MUST ignore an initial plaintext packet from a client if its total size is less than 1200 octets. +Similarly, servers MUST ensure that the first handshake packet they send to +clients, and any retransmissions of those octets, has a QUIC packet size that is +the same as the received initial client packet, unless the server knows the PMTU +to the client to be smaller. Sending a packet of this size ensures that the This "smaller" clause here means that the server-to-client path could end up with a PMTU less than 1200. I think that you need to set a minimum of 1200 here explicitly. -- You are receiving this because you are subscribed to this thread.
